Wind River Support Network

HomeDefectsLIN10-2804
Fixed

LIN10-2804 : qemumips : runqemu qemumips slirp nographic qemuparams='-m 512' caught calltrace

Created: Dec 19, 2017    Updated: Dec 3, 2018
Resolved Date: Apr 24, 2018
Found In Version: 10.17.41.1
Fix Version: 10.17.41.7
Severity: Standard
Applicable for: Wind River Linux LTS 17
Component/s: Kernel

Description

xxxx@host:/90/qemumips/build$ runqemu qemumips slirp nographic qemuparams="-m 512"
runqemu - INFO - Assuming MACHINE = qemumips
runqemu - INFO - Running MACHINE=qemumips bitbake -e...
runqemu - INFO - MACHINE: qemumips
runqemu - INFO - DEPLOY_DIR_IMAGE: /90/qemumips/build/tmp/deploy/images/qemumips
runqemu - INFO - Running ls -t /90/qemumips/build/tmp/deploy/images/qemumips/*.qemuboot.conf...
runqemu - INFO - CONFFILE: /90/qemumips/build/tmp/deploy/images/qemumips/wrlinux-image-glibc-std-qemumips-20161031060552.qemuboot.conf
runqemu - INFO - Continuing with the following parameters:

KERNEL: [/90/qemumips/build/tmp/deploy/images/qemumips/vmlinux]
MACHINE: [qemumips]
FSTYPE: [ext4]
ROOTFS: [/90/qemumips/build/tmp/deploy/images/qemumips/wrlinux-image-glibc-std-qemumips-20161031060552.rootfs.ext4]
CONFFILE: [/90/qemumips/build/tmp/deploy/images/qemumips/wrlinux-image-glibc-std-qemumips-20161031060552.qemuboot.conf]

runqemu - INFO - Running ldd /90/qemumips/build/tmp/sysroots/x86_64-linux/usr/bin/qemu-system-mips...
runqemu - INFO - Running /90/qemumips/build/tmp/sysroots/x86_64-linux/usr/bin/qemu-system-mips   -nographic -m 512 -machine malta  -m 512 -drive file=/90/qemumips/build/tmp/deploy/images/qemumips/wrlinux-image-glibc-std-qemumips-20161031060552.rootfs.ext4,if=virtio,format=raw -vga cirrus -show-cursor -usb -usbdevice tablet -device virtio-rng-pci -kernel /90/qemumips/build/tmp/deploy/images/qemumips/vmlinux -append 'root=/dev/vda rw highres=off  console=ttyS0 mem=512M ip=dhcp console=ttyS0 console=tty'
[    0.000000] Linux version 4.8.0-rc7-rt1-WR9.0.0.0_preempt-rt  (gcc version 6.2.0 (GCC) ) #2 PREEMPT RT Mon Oct 31 14:17:11 CST 2016
[    0.000000] earlycon: uart8250 at I/O port 0x3f8 (options '38400n8')
[    0.000000] bootconsole [uart8250] enabled
[    0.000000] CPU0 revision is: 00019300 (MIPS 24Kc)
[    0.000000] FPU revision is: 00739300
[    0.000000] MIPS: machine is mti,malta
[    0.000000] Software DMA cache coherency enabled
[    0.000000] Determined physical RAM map:
[    0.000000]  memory: 10000000 @ 00000000 (usable)
[    0.000000] User-defined physical RAM map:
[    0.000000]  memory: 20000000 @ 00000000 (usable)
[    0.000000] Initrd not found or empty - disabling initrd
[    0.000000] Zone ranges:
[    0.000000]   DMA      [mem 0x0000000000000000-0x0000000000ffffff]
[    0.000000]   Normal   [mem 0x0000000001000000-0x000000001fffffff]
[    0.000000] Movable zone start for each node
[    0.000000] Early memory node ranges
[    0.000000]   node   0: [mem 0x0000000000000000-0x000000001fffffff]
[    0.000000] Initmem setup node 0 [mem 0x0000000000000000-0x000000001fffffff]
[    0.000000] On node 0 totalpages: 131072
[    0.000000] free_area_init_node: node 0, pgdat 80afc4a8, node_mem_map 810003c0
[    0.000000]   DMA zone: 36 pages used for memmap
[    0.000000]   DMA zone: 0 pages reserved
[    0.000000]   DMA zone: 4096 pages, LIFO batch:0
[    0.000000]   Normal zone: 1116 pages used for memmap
[    0.000000]   Normal zone: 126976 pages, LIFO batch:31
[    0.000000] Primary instruction cache 2kB, VIPT, 2-way, linesize 16 bytes.
[    0.000000] Primary data cache 2kB, 2-way, VIPT, no aliases, linesize 16 bytes
[    0.000000] pcpu-alloc: s0 r0 d32768 u32768 alloc=1*32768
[    0.000000] pcpu-alloc: [0] 0 
[    0.000000] Built 1 zonelists in Zone order, mobility grouping on.  Total pages: 129920
[    0.000000] Kernel command line: root=/dev/vda rw highres=off  console=ttyS0 mem=512M ip=dhcp console=ttyS0 console=tty
[    0.000000] PID hash table entries: 2048 (order: 1, 8192 bytes)
[    0.000000] Dentry cache hash table entries: 65536 (order: 6, 262144 bytes)
[    0.000000] Inode-cache hash table entries: 32768 (order: 5, 131072 bytes)
[    0.000000] Writing ErrCtl register=00000000
[    0.000000] Readback ErrCtl register=00000000
[    0.000000] Data bus error, epc == 8011cd50, ra == 80201d00
[    0.000000] Oops[#1]:
[    0.000000] CPU: 0 PID: 0 Comm: swapper Not tainted 4.8.0-rc7-rt1-WR9.0.0.0_preempt-rt #2
[    0.000000] task: 80a6dc40 task.stack: 80a68000
[    0.000000] $ 0   : 00000000 00000001 80000000 80a6dc40
[    0.000000] $ 4   : 9fc00000 80a6dc40 9fc00f80 00000000
[    0.000000] $ 8   : 80afc734 80a9b004 00009000 80a69d20
[    0.000000] $12   : 00000000 ffffffff 80a69d20 00000480
[    0.000000] $16   : 80afc6ec 814773e4 38e38e39 80c70000
[    0.000000] $20   : 809ccc6c 00000000 814773c0 814773c0
[    0.000000] $24   : 00000000 80afc6ec                  
[    0.000000] $28   : 80a68000 80a69d50 00000001 80201d00
[    0.000000] Hi    : 00000000
[    0.000000] Lo    : 00000000
[    0.000000] epc   : 8011cd50 clear_page+0x0/0x128
[    0.000000] ra    : 80201d00 get_page_from_freelist+0xb44/0xb94
[    0.000000] Status: 10000002 KERNEL EXL 
[    0.000000] Cause : 0080041c (ExcCode 07)
[    0.000000] PrId  : 00019300 (MIPS 24Kc)
[    0.000000] Modules linked in:
[    0.000000] Process swapper (pid: 0, threadinfo=80a68000, task=80a6dc40, tls=00000000)
[    0.000000] Stack : 30a69d8c 00000050 0000001b 80a69e3c 00000001 80c328b0 00000001 80c60000
[    0.000000]    00000000 024080c0 809e0000 80a9daf0 80b0079c 80a9b010 80afc8c4 80a9b004
[    0.000000]    ffffffff 80a9b004 00000060 80a9b010 80afcb74 00000001 00000000 00000000
[    0.000000]    024080c0 80c60000 00000001 00000000 80a70000 80c70000 00008000 802023ac
[    0.000000]    00000021 10000000 00000006 8052935c 80c30000 00000000 80afcb74 00000000
[    0.000000]    ...
[    0.000000] Call Trace:
[    0.000000] [<8011cd50>] clear_page+0x0/0x128
[    0.000000] [<80201d00>] get_page_from_freelist+0xb44/0xb94
[    0.000000] [<802023ac>] __alloc_pages_nodemask+0x11c/0xd00
[    0.000000] [<80202fa8>] __get_free_pages+0x18/0x60
[    0.000000] [<801191b8>] setup_zero_pages+0x1c/0x98
[    0.000000] [<80b0d0e0>] mem_init+0x44/0x54
[    0.000000] [<80b05988>] start_kernel+0x218/0x4c0
[    0.000000] [<80877f70>] kernel_entry+0x0/0x40
[    0.000000] 
[    0.000000] 
[    0.000000] Code: 02002025  1000f88d  3c1380c3 <34860f80> cc9e0000  cc9e0010  cc9e0020  cc9e0030  cc9e0040 
[    0.000000] ---[ end trace 0000000000000001 ]---
[    0.000000] Kernel panic - not syncing: Attempted to kill the idle task!

Steps to Reproduce


$ /lpg-build/cdc/fast_prod/wrlinux90/WRL90_GIT/wrlinux-9/setup.sh --machines qemumips --distros wrlinux --base-url git://pek-git.wrs.com --dl-layers
$ . environment-setup-x86_64-wrlinuxsdk-linux 
$ . oe-init-build-env
$ bitbake wrlinux-image-glibc-std

$ runqemu qemumips slirp nographic qemuparams="-m 512"

Other Downloads


Live chat
Online